We are seeking a talented Principal Software Architect to lead the team of engineers focused on Buy Side workflows for the LiquidityBook OMS Platform. You will ensure the integration of high-performance Java backend systems with responsive, modern frontend applications, working across both new product initiatives and the modernization of existing systems. This is a hands-on role, where you will be contributing yourself and guiding the team. 

 

Responsibilities: 

  • Manage and empower a team of engineers to design and develop scalable, high-performance OMS features, supporting new initiatives and enhancing legacy systems. 

  • Lead by example through hands-on coding and detailed technical contributions. 

  • Establish and enforce engineering strategy, standards, and best practices across the team and organization. 

  • Mentor engineers, driving professional growth and cultivating a culture of technical excellence. 

  • Champion system modernization in performance, reliability, and maintainability, overseeing refactoring and technology upgrades. 

  • Participate in code reviews, technical design sessions, and the resolution of complex problems to ensure quality deliverables. 

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ure seamless integration between backend services and frontend user interfaces, leveraging our established tech stack. 

 

Required Qualifications: 

  • 10+ years of software engineering experience with a strong emphasis on both enterprise Java development and frontend development 

  • Proven experience architecting and delivering large-scale distributed systems. 

  • Deep understanding of software architecture, design patterns, algorithms, and data structures. 

  • Track record of setting technical direction and mentoring engineering teams. 

  • Outstanding problem-solving and communication skills. 

 

Preferred Qualifications: 

  • Experience in financial trading application development, especially with OMS, EMS, or similar systems. 

  • Familiarity with multi-threaded programming, high-performance/low-latency architectures, and scalable frontend systems. 

  • Knowledge of trading workflows, FIX protocol, or market data integration. 

  • Leadership in driving system modernization and technology evolution in enterprise environments. 

Education:

  • Bachelor's in computer science or relevant

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
